How many of the ten compensation variables does your company offer? Base pay: An employee's salary Augmented pay: A one-time payment that ranges in form from overtime to stock options Indirect pay: Traditional benefits such as health insurance and pension Works-pay: Company-provided resources that employees would otherwise have to purchase in order to do their job, such as cell phones, uniforms, laptop computers Perks-pay: Upgrades that leverage the employer's ability to enhance employee compensation and provide lifestyle enhancement for the employee Opportunity for advancement: Opportunities for employees to climb the corporate ladder Opportunity for growth: Firm-provided opportunities to learn and grow on the job Psychic income: Emotional satisfaction derived from the work and the workplace Quality of life: Balancing work and the rest of life X factor: Individual wants and needs that, with imagination, employers may be able to satisfy
In their desire to satisfy employees, many organizations focus too narrowly on money as compensation. Of course money is an important factor, but employees?and prospective employees?are demanding more. Learning opportunities, advancement prospects, emotional rewards, and the ability to pursue a particular lifestyle are incentivies that are drawing today's top-level workers to forward- thinking organizations. Company leaders must retool their old pay systems and create new ones if they are to attract, motivate, and maintain a quality workforce.
